Broadstairs teen singer Harmony Bo releases debut single

Harmony Bo has released her single through Wantsum Music?

A Broadstairs teenager has released her first single through Wantsum Music youth label.

Harmony Bo,17, is already a seasoned punk singer and songwriter having performed both locally and nationally for several years.

To date Harmony has appeared at Camden’s Good Mixer, Brighton’s Great Escape Festival and the 40th Anniversary of Jeremy Corbyn joining Parliament. Closer to home she has performed shows at venues such as The Tom Thumb Theatre, WhereElse? and Olbys Soul Cafe and has a strong local following.

Her single “Suffragette” was written when she was 15 but at that time she did not have the resources to release her own music.

She then joined Pie Factory Musics Emerging Artist Programme in 2023 where she learnt about the music industry and also with the support of Wantsum Music? how to release her work.

The song is described as “a lyrical slice of Ska Punk weaving sharp, angular guitar, stabbing organs and a driving, polka punk drum beat. “

It is an angry reaction to the overturning of the Roe Vs Wade abortion case in the US.

“Suffragette” has been produced by Harmony with the help of Emerging Artists mentor Mike Targett, tastefully building the track up from its stripped back guitar and drum origins.

Harmony has been a keen member of Wantsum’s parent Pie Factory Music for many years, before joining their most recent ‘Emerging Artists’ programme in 2023 to help further develop her music career. She works with drummer and fellow Emerging Artist Dylan Watling.

Wantsum Music? was started as part of Ramsgate based charity Pie Factory Music’s Emerging Artist Programme. A group of young, talented and diverse East Kent musicians came together in 2021 to help develop their passion for music and their joint desire to progress their musical careers.

Control of Wantsum Music has been passed down through subsequent Emerging Artists and currently resides with 2023’s cohort: Harmony Bo Hampson, Quinn Bailey, Jan Quindoyos, Charley Brown and Dylan Watling.

Wantsum Music? is hosted by Pie Factory Music through funding from Youth Music, and with previous support from Thanet-based global record label Moshi Moshi Music and Berlin-based City Slang Records.
